Point B is on line segment AC

Given: AB = 4x - 6, AC = 2x + 10, and BC=4, determine the numerical length of AC.

Answer:

22

Explanation:

AB + BC = AC

4x -6 + 4 = 2x + 10 Combine like terms

4x -2 = 2x + 10 Subtract 2s from both sides of the equation

2x -2 = 10 Add 2 to both sides

2x = 12 Divide both sides by 2

x = 6

Plug in 6 for x in AC

2x + 10

2(6) + 10

12 + 10

22
